Come face to face with one of the Incas’ most astonishing feats of engineering on this 6-Day Great Inca Trail to Pariacaca trekking adventure. Venture far off the beaten path southeast of Lima to hike one of the most breathtaking and well-preserved sections of Inca road in South America, accompanied by a traditional llama caravan. Pass through the Nor-Yauyos reserve, cross a stunning high-altitude mountain pass, and keep an eye out for rupestrian imagery. If travel broadens the mind, this trip will shatter the parameters.

Indulge in the adventure of a lifetime when you hike a pristine section of the Great Inca Trail, a 25,000-mile road network widely regarded as one of the world’s greatest engineering marvels. For five days you’ll traverse a remote, rugged and spectacular swath of Peru’s Northern Andes that very few tourists have ever visited. You will follow in the footsteps of the Incas – treading their great road, camping at ancient refuges and relying on llamas to carry your luggage – under the watchful guidance of an experienced local guide, chef, and porters.
